Gutter FAQs
What Are Rain Gutters and What Is Their Value for a House?
Rain gutters are ditches or narrow passageways installed around a roof’s corner.
Not all homes or edifices require rain gutters, but most houses have them.
Their primary purpose is to accumulate and direct water away from your home’s foundation.
Gutters help avoid water harm to a residence's exterior and interior while guarding it from structural issues resulting from long-term water harm.
How Regularly Should Gutters Be Cleaned to Stop Obstructions and Water Impairment?
Ideally, homeowners should maintain their rain gutters twice a year at minimum, once in the spring and once in the fall; however, the twice-yearly schedule isn’t a rigid rule.
For example, homeowners with trees near their homes might want to clean their gutters more often to avoid clogs caused by leaves or waste.
It’s a good notion to service rain gutters regularly to avoid excess or leakage that can lead to water damage.

What Are the Usual Signs of Gutter Damage?
There are quite a few typical signs that reveal a residence's gutter must have repair that include but are not confined to the following:
- Leaks - Homeowners may observe water dropping or pouring from their rain gutters rather than being adequately diverted away from their homes
- Rusting - Visible rusting in the form of flaky patches or russet discolorations can suggest that the metal material of the rain gutters is weakening or thinning.
- Sagging - Rain gutters should be firmly fastened to the roof line. If they are pulling away or sagging, they might not be able to carry out their chief function.
- Peeling Paint - Rain gutters with paint or covering that’s flaking off need fixing to make sure the metal underneath does not rust or deteriorate.
- Standing Water - Water gathering at or near a home's footing can indicate the gutters are not doing their job.
- Impaired Landscaping - Fungus, wear, deterioration to trees or lawns, and plant rotting can all indicate gutters that need repair.
What Are the Different Kinds of Gutters Available?
The four different kinds of rain gutters are:
- K-style - This is one of the most popular models and are readily recognizable by their level backsides and rectangular drains. K-style gutters are simply install but difficult to purify.
- Half-Round - This is another one of the most favored types and has a half-moon shaped design with round spouts. Half-round gutters are long-lasting but vulnerable to debris. They are also more expensive to install.
- Custom Fascia - As the name might suggest, this model is a custom-built seamless gutter system that attaches to a house’s fascia board. It has a larger design for denser water flow; however, custom fascia gutters are pricey and challenging to establish.
- Box-Style - This kind of gutter is over-sized and has a high back section that nests under roof shingles. It is robust and can deal with substantial water flow, but it expensive and misses aesthetic appeal.

What Are the Varieties of Substances Used For Rain Gutters?
There are different forms of components used in gutters with the most frequent being vinyl and aluminum. These materials include:
- Vinyl - Vinyl gutters are straightforward to install; however, they are not the most strong and have a life expectancy averaging 10 to 20 years.
- Aluminum - Aluminum gutters are rust-resistant and lightweight. They have a life expectancy of 20-30 years on average but have a elevated chance of fracturing.
- Galvanized Steel - Zinc-coated steel gutters are strong and durable, but in most cases, they will necessitate professional mounting. These gutters last 20-30 years but require frequent maintenance to prevent oxidation.
- Zinc - Zinc gutters are resistant to rust and easy to maintain. They are remarkably enduring, with most zinc rain gutters averaging life expectancies of 80 years or more.
- Copper - Copper rain gutters are the most expensive alternative, but they can be quite worth it. They call for expert installation and do not warp or corrode.
What Type of Coating is Used for Rain Gutters?
Gutters don’t always need to be painted yet when they do, it should be with finish specifically tailored for outdoor and metal surfaces.
For this objective, oil-based paint seems to work the best since they are robust, enduring, and can handle constant exposure to the elements.
It’s also a beneficial idea to prime the rain gutters beforehand to painting them.
Can Extreme Weather Conditions Harm Gutters?
Yes. Harsh weather events like heavy rain or snow can inflict destruction on a house's gutter. High winds can also cause rain gutters to become loose or pull away from roofs.
Furthermore, dropped materials caused by weather events can lead to sagging, damaged, or otherwise harmed rain gutters.
Periodic check-ups and cleaning can help avert weather damage from worsening into larger problems over time.

Are Rain Gutter Add-ons Required?
Some rain gutter accessories can assist boost the longevity and performance of a residence's gutters.
For example, rain gutter guards help by stopping junk from clogging gutters.
Downspout elongations, on the other hand, help direct water even further away from a house's footing.
You can also contemplate other add-ons but be sure to pick them according to your needs and budget.
